Michael E. Richard

54 years old

Michael Earl Richard, 54 years old, lives in Liberty, Texas. Michael has also lived in Humble, Texas; New Orleans, Louisiana; Mandeville, Louisiana and Hammond, Louisiana.

Public Records

Arrest Records

Scroll